O que é Network protocols

O que é Network protocols

Network protocols são conjuntos de regras e procedimentos que permitem a comunicação entre dispositivos em uma rede de computadores. Eles definem como os dados são transmitidos, recebidos e processados, garantindo a interoperabilidade entre diferentes sistemas e dispositivos.

Tipos de Network protocols

Existem diversos tipos de network protocols, cada um com sua própria função e características. Alguns dos mais comuns incluem o TCP/IP, que é amplamente utilizado na Internet, o UDP, que é mais rápido mas menos confiável, e o ICMP, que é utilizado para diagnóstico de problemas de rede.

Funcionamento dos Network protocols

Os network protocols funcionam de forma hierárquica, com camadas que se comunicam entre si para garantir a transmissão correta dos dados. Cada camada tem sua própria função e responsabilidades, e a comunicação entre elas é feita através de mensagens e comandos específicos.

Importância dos Network protocols

Os network protocols são essenciais para o funcionamento das redes de computadores, pois garantem que os dados sejam transmitidos de forma segura, eficiente e confiável. Eles também permitem a comunicação entre dispositivos de diferentes fabricantes e sistemas operacionais.

Padrões de Network protocols

Os network protocols são padronizados por organizações como a IEEE e a IETF, que definem as especificações técnicas e os requisitos para a implementação dos protocolos. Isso garante a compatibilidade entre os diferentes dispositivos e sistemas que utilizam os mesmos protocolos.

Desafios na implementação de Network protocols

A implementação de network protocols pode ser desafiadora devido à complexidade dos sistemas de rede e à diversidade de dispositivos e tecnologias envolvidas. É importante garantir a compatibilidade e a segurança dos protocolos para evitar problemas de comunicação e vulnerabilidades de segurança.

Evolução dos Network protocols

Os network protocols estão em constante evolução para atender às demandas crescentes das redes de computadores modernas. Novos protocolos são desenvolvidos para suportar maior largura de banda, menor latência e maior segurança, garantindo a eficiência e a confiabilidade das comunicações.

Aplicações dos Network protocols

Os network protocols são utilizados em uma variedade de aplicações, desde a comunicação de dados em redes locais até a transmissão de vídeos em alta definição pela Internet. Eles são essenciais para o funcionamento de serviços como e-mail, redes sociais, streaming de mídia e jogos online.

Desafios futuros dos Network protocols

Com o crescimento exponencial do tráfego de dados e a proliferação de dispositivos conectados à Internet, os network protocols enfrentarão novos desafios no futuro. Será necessário desenvolver protocolos mais eficientes, escaláveis e seguros para garantir a continuidade da comunicação em redes cada vez mais complexas e interconectadas.